Describe Intemittent Mandatory Ventilation (IMV)
Mandatory breaths are delivered at set tidal volumes and rates, and the patient can breathe on his own in between through a unidirectional valve in between (Fig 5). Unlike in ACV, a machine breath is not initated with each patient effort - thus the risk of overventilation is reduced. A refinement of this mode is Synchronous Intermittent Mandatory Ventilation (SIMV) - here the machine breaths are synchronized to patient efforts if it falls within a "window period" of the cycle.
